An original, UK-supplied, right-hand drive example of the elegant Paul Bracq-designed 3.4-litre E24, powered by BMW's sonorous 215bhp M30 straight-six with a smooth 4-speed automatic gearbox Epitomising style and mechanical prowess when they arrived on the motoring scene in 1976, these beautiful coupés will always stand the test of time with the ability to 'wow' anywhere This beautiful example was supplied new by Alec Norman (Garage) Ltd of Bedford on 29/05/1987 in Zinnoberrot with a black leather interior The well stamped service book received its 20th entry on the 06/02/2025 and the odometer reading is a mere 49,972 miles (at time of cataloguing) Patently well cared for and lavished with attention in recent years, the car benefits from a stainless steel exhaust fitted some 1,000 miles ago Previously in long-term storage, the car’s detailed history file incudes some 24 MOTs and the toolkit is present Professionally detailed and freshly serviced for the auction, despite the lack of ro...
